Same problem here with a MacBook Air recently upgraded to Sierra. The issue
for us is that 4D crashes anytime a 4D Write area is touched. I am running
Sierra on an iMac with no issues and thought it may be related to the
laptop, however see the release notes for 15.3, what they state is
consistent with our experience. Running 4D on the older build of Sierra
10.12.1 is fine, not so on the more recent build.
